Kimball Electronics

Kimball Electronics, Inc. provides electronics, assemblies, and contract manufacturing solutions. Its electronics manufacturing services include engineering and supply chain support for customers in the automotive, medical, and industrial end markets. Its contract manufacturing organization solutions cover the production of medical disposables and drug delivery services, such as precision molded plastics, cold chain management, and drug integration. The company also produces and tests printed circuit board assemblies, assembles medical, automotive, and industrial products, and provides clean room assembly, cold chain, and product sterilization management. Additional offerings include design and supply chain services, rapid prototyping and new product introduction support, product design and process validation and qualification, industrialization and automation of manufacturing processes, reliability testing, aftermarket services, and product life cycle management. It operates in the United States, China, Mexico, Poland, Romania, Thailand, and internationally. Kimball Electronics, Inc. was founded in 1961 and is headquartered in Jasper, Indiana.

Kimball Electronics Guides Fiscal 2027 Sales to $1.535-$1.56 Billion After 4% Annual Decline

Kimball Electronics reported fourth-quarter net sales of $371.6 million, a 5% sequential increase, and issued fiscal 2027 guidance calling for net sales of $1.535 billion to $1.56 billion, a 7% to 9% increase over fiscal 2026. That guidance splits into 3% to 5% organic growth and roughly $60 million in sales from the newly acquired Helvoet Polymer Technologies business, with Medical expected to grow at a strong single-digit to modest double-digit pace and supply upward of a third of total sales. The outlook follows a full fiscal year in which net sales fell 4% to $1.431 billion, with automotive, still the largest vertical at 46% of quarterly sales, down 7% for the year. Cash generation was the bright spot: $42.4 million in quarterly operating cash flow, a tenth straight positive quarter, total debt down to $116.6 million, the lowest in more than four years, and Cash Conversion Days of 82, the best in 17 quarters. Adjusted operating income margin was 4.9% for the quarter versus 5.2% a year earlier, adjusted diluted earnings per share swung to a loss of $0.01 from positive $0.34, and fiscal 2027 margin guidance of 4.4% to 4.7% is flat to lower than fiscal 2026's 4.6% even as capital expenditures are planned at $50 million to $60 million.

Kimball Electronics guides fiscal 2027 sales to $1.535B-$1.56B

Kimball Electronics projects fiscal 2027 net sales of $1.535 billion to $1.56 billion, including $60 million from its Helvoet acquisition. The company expects organic sales growth of 3% to 5%, with Medical organic growth in the high single to low double-digit range, Industrial in line with the company average, and Automotive flattish for the year. Adjusted operating income is estimated at 4.4% to 4.7% of net sales, and capital expenditures are expected to be $50 million to $60 million. Management said the dilutive impact of the Indianapolis facility ramp is roughly offset by the accretive benefit from Helvoet. For the fourth quarter, net sales were $371.6 million, adjusted operating income was $18.1 million or 4.9% of net sales, and cash from operations was $42.4 million.
